What is a career average revalued earnings scheme?
This Factsheet looks at the variations of the career average revalued earnings pension scheme (CARE scheme) that have developed to meet the changing priorities of employers in an ever more complex world.
A CARE scheme is a type of defined benefit scheme that uses your averaged pensionable earnings over the lifetime of your active scheme membership. Therefore, the definition of your pensionable earnings is important in this type of scheme.
